Latest Patents
Cripps' latest patents include a sophisticated liquid fuel dispensing system. This system features a plurality of dispensing pumps that generate electric pulses according to the volume of fuel dispensed. A central control unit is responsible for processing payments. Each pump is connected to the central control via a data transmission link and includes a pulse store that accumulates pulses generated during dispensing operations. The system also incorporates a sampling mechanism at the central control that updates outputs from the pulse stores at each sampling. This innovative design allows for efficient management of fuel dispensing transactions.
